Alice man gets over 22 years for shipping meth from Mexico in bricks CORPUS CHRISTI — A 35-year-old Alice resident has been ordered to federal prison for his role in receiving meth using a commercial carrier service, announced Acting U.S. Attorney John G.E. Marck.Scott Garza pleaded guilty Dec. 30, 2025, to knowingly and intentionally possessing meth with the intent to distribute it.U.S. District Judge David S. Morales has now ordered Garza to serve 265 months in federal prison to be immediately followed by five years of supervised release.On Aug. 7, 2025, law enforcement identified an international package shipped from Mexico ...
